What if you'd bought Netflix in 2020?

Netflix opened 2020 near $33 (split-adjusted) as the original streaming pioneer, then watched a locked-down planet binge its entire catalogue at once. The pandemic that froze the world handed subscription video its single greatest year — and a 2022 hangover its holders hadn't yet imagined.
